同一个服务器两个网站端口能一样吗,探讨同一服务器上两个网站端口相同的问题,可行性与潜在风险分析
- 综合资讯
- 2024-12-05 03:52:56
- 2

同一服务器上两个网站端口相同存在可行性,但存在潜在风险。需考虑服务器配置和操作系统限制,以及可能导致的服务冲突、性能下降等问题。建议谨慎操作,确保稳定性和安全性。...
同一服务器上两个网站端口相同存在可行性,但存在潜在风险。需考虑服务器配置和操作系统限制,以及可能导致的服务冲突、性能下降等问题。建议谨慎操作,确保稳定性和安全性。
随着互联网技术的不断发展,越来越多的企业选择将自己的业务迁移到线上,而同一服务器上部署多个网站已经成为一种常见的部署方式,在部署过程中,许多企业对同一服务器上两个网站端口能否相同这一问题产生了疑问,本文将针对这一问题进行探讨,分析同一服务器上两个网站端口相同的可行性与潜在风险。
同一服务器上两个网站端口相同的可行性
1、端口概述
端口是计算机网络中用于识别不同服务的通信接口,在TCP/IP协议中,端口分为两种类型:知名端口和动态端口,知名端口是指0-1023之间的端口,用于识别常见的网络服务;动态端口是指1024-65535之间的端口,用于临时分配给应用程序。
2、端口复用技术
同一服务器上两个网站端口相同的可行性主要得益于端口复用技术,端口复用技术允许多个应用程序共享同一个端口,实现数据的传输,常见的端口复用技术包括:
(1)Nginx:Nginx是一款高性能的Web服务器和反向代理服务器,支持端口复用功能,通过配置Nginx,可以实现同一服务器上多个网站共享同一个端口。
(2)Tomcat:Tomcat是Java应用服务器,也支持端口复用,通过配置Tomcat,可以实现同一服务器上多个Java应用共享同一个端口。
3、可行性分析
同一服务器上两个网站端口相同的可行性较高,通过端口复用技术,可以实现多个网站共享同一个端口,提高服务器资源利用率,降低成本。
同一服务器上两个网站端口相同的潜在风险
1、资源竞争
当同一服务器上两个网站共享同一个端口时,可能会出现资源竞争的情况,两个网站同时访问数据库,可能会导致数据库响应速度变慢,影响用户体验。
2、安全风险
共享同一个端口可能导致安全风险,如果一个网站被黑客攻击,攻击者可能会通过端口复用技术对另一个网站进行攻击。
3、维护难度
同一服务器上两个网站端口相同,会增加维护难度,在出现问题时,需要同时排查两个网站,导致问题解决周期延长。
1、避免端口冲突
在部署网站时,应尽量避免端口冲突,可以通过以下方法实现:
(1)使用不同的端口:为每个网站分配一个独立的端口,确保端口不冲突。
(2)使用虚拟主机:通过虚拟主机技术,实现同一服务器上多个网站共享同一个IP地址,每个网站使用不同的端口。
2、加强安全防护
针对同一服务器上两个网站端口相同可能带来的安全风险,应加强安全防护措施:
(1)定期更新系统软件和应用程序,修复漏洞。
(2)使用防火墙、入侵检测系统等安全设备,提高网络安全防护能力。
(3)对敏感数据采用加密传输,防止数据泄露。
3、简化维护流程
为降低维护难度,可以采取以下措施:
(1)对服务器进行合理分区,实现不同网站的独立运行。
(2)建立完善的监控体系,实时监测服务器运行状态。
(3)制定详细的故障处理流程,提高问题解决效率。
同一服务器上两个网站端口相同的可行性较高,但存在一定的潜在风险,在实际部署过程中,企业应根据自身需求,合理选择端口配置方案,并采取相应的安全防护措施,以确保网站稳定运行。
本文链接:https://zhitaoyun.cn/1327980.html
发表评论